mrp69 Posted June 26, 2008 Posted June 26, 2008 hey guys my 240z has a 3.5l v8 with a supra 5 speed box in it and diff has just been changed to a r180 3.54 ratio. the car is still reving very high in all gears for example in 5th gear at a 110km its reving at 5000rpm what could be the problem diff has been changed which i thought would of fixed the problem could it be the gearbox?? any ideas need help Peter Quote
Scoota G Posted June 26, 2008 Posted June 26, 2008 Just a couple of questions. What is the maximum speed in 1st 2nd 3rd and 4th? What is the Highest speed you have had the car up to? Is the speedo accurate? Is the tachometer accurate? This will give a better picture of what is going on. Also try to find out some more information on the gearbox and if you can, who did the conversion. Quote
C.A.R. Posted June 26, 2008 Posted June 26, 2008 Are you positive the new diff is a 3.54? Also, how do you know the Tacho is accurate? Quote
mrp69 Posted June 26, 2008 Author Posted June 26, 2008 1st 40km 2nd 80km 3rd 100km havent pushed it past that and when in 5th on the freeway 110km 5000rpm at 130km 6000rpm in 5th speedo is accurate tachometer im pretty sure is accurate due to the sound of the car and how loud it is it might be the gearbox ratios im not sure but diff was changed peter Quote
mrp69 Posted June 26, 2008 Author Posted June 26, 2008 diff was purchased off 240ZR (nick off this forum) how can i check the tachometer?? Quote
Scoota G Posted June 26, 2008 Posted June 26, 2008 You can get a clip on one at most auto shops. Quote
